Net Perceptions Puts Proven Business Builder at the Helm; Entrepreneur, Don C. Peterson Succeeds Company Founder, Snyder, as CEO

MINNEAPOLIS--(BUSINESS WIRE)--May 29, 2001--Net Perceptions, Inc. (Nasdaq:NETP) today announced that it has appointed Don C. Peterson as the company's new president and CEO. Peterson is an entrepreneur with a proven track record for building successful businesses.

"Net Perceptions is solving real demand-side business problems for some of the world's largest retailers," said Peterson. "This is a unique company with proven technology and an excellent customer portfolio. I'm very excited to build from such a strong foundation."

Peterson, 39, has more than 17 years of technology-related experience including founding Shamrock Computer Resources in 1989. He served as CEO and president of the IT services and e-commerce application development firm, growing it to a 500-person operation with six offices and annual revenues of $44 million in less than seven years. In 1996, Peterson sold the company to Renaissance Worldwide, Inc., where he served as a lead executive until 1999. Prior to Renaissance, Peterson held sales and consulting positions with Arthur Andersen (now Accenture), IBM and Cap Gemini.

"Don is a dynamic leader with the proven ability to rapidly build and effectively manage complex, technology-oriented businesses," said Will Lansing, NBCi CEO and Net Perceptions board member. "He has a lot to offer Net Perceptions and will be able to leverage more than a decade's worth of sales, marketing and strategic management experience to help grow the company and realize its full potential."

Peterson, who will also become a member of the company's Board of Directors, succeeds Steven J. Snyder, who had previously announced his plans to leave the post upon the naming of a successor. One of the company's original founders, Snyder plans to continue to serve the company as chairman of Net Perceptions' Board of Directors.

About Net Perceptions

Net Perceptions (Nasdaq:NETP) provides intelligent demand generation solutions to multi-channel retailers. Its Retail Revelations suite of software and services measurably improves merchandising, marketing and advertising effectiveness by providing actionable insight into product, promotion and customer interactions. Founded in 1996, Net Perceptions is headquartered in Minneapolis and has offices throughout the United States and in Europe. Customers include market leaders such as Best Buy, Brylane, GUS (Great Universal Stores), JC Penney, Kmart and Tesco. For more information visit http://www.netperceptions.com or call 800-466-0711.
